
The following input options are available:
● Start dosing
● Hold / continue dosing
– When this function is activated, it will pause the dosing. When it is deactivated, the
dosing will continue
● Stop dosing
– Sets the digital output to "Off" and resets the dosing counter
● Zero adjust
– Starts the automatic zero point adjustment. This function employs the existing
configurations and presumes that the process conditions are prepared for the zero point
adjustment routine
● Reset totalizer
– Resets one of the internal totalizers 1, 2 or 3 (depending on configuration)
● Resets all totalizers simultaneously
● Freeze signal
– Freezes all currently measured values in the display and outputs
● Force signal
– Forces all outputs to adopt the value selected in the menu. If the value 100% is selected,
the current output will show 20 mA and the frequency output will show 10.000 kHz when
the external output is activated
WARNING
Changing polarity
Changing the polarity triggers the signal input to execute the set functionality.

Totalizers
Totalizer functions
The device has three independent totalizers that can be used to total the massflow, volumeflow,
corrected volumeflow, fraction A (volumeflow or massflow) or fraction B (volumeflow or
massflow).
The totalizers can be configured to count balance (net flow), positive flow or negative flow.
In case of failure in the system, the totalizer fail safe mode can be set to:
- Hold (default): the totalizer holds the last value before the failure occurred
- Run: the totalizer continues counting the actual measured value
